Here's a list of the state boards of nursing, their contact information, and continuing-education (CE) or practice requirements for RNs renewing their licenses. Even states with no such requirements charge a fee and require timely renewal. Requirements for reinstating a license, renewing an inactive license, or renewing an advanced practice license may be different; for details, contact your state board. If you're an LPN, please contact your state board of nursing for details. District of Columbia Board of Nursing Web site: http://www.dchealth.dc.gov Phone: 202-724-4900 Renewal requirements: 24 contact hours of practice-related CE within the past 2 years. May be waived if, within the past 2 years, you have served as a speakerat an approved CE program or have had an article, chapter, or book you edited or authored published. Florida Board of Nursing Web site: http://www.doh.state.fl.us/mqa/renewal/nurrenewals/nur_renewal.html Phone: 850-487-3284 Renewal requirements: 25 contact hours of board-approved CE every 2 years (waived during first renewal period if you were licensed by exam), including 1 contact hour on HIV/AIDS, 2 contact hours on prevention of medical errors, and 1 contact hour on domestic violence. You may substitute courses in end-of-life or palliative health care for courses in HIV/AIDS education or domestic violence. Iowa Board of Nursing Web site: http://www.state.ia.us/government/nursing Phone: 515-281-3264 E-mail: [email protected] Renewal requirements: 36 contact hours of CE within the past 3 years. If license was first issued less than 3 years ago, 24 contact hours are required. If you regularly work with dependent adults or children, you must also complete 2 hours of training in abuse identification and reporting every 5 years. Kansas State Board of Nursing Web site: http://www.ksbn.org Phone: 785-296-4929 Renewal requirements: 30 contact hours of interactive or independent CE within the past 2 years (waived for the first renewal after licensure). Nevada State Board of Nursing Web site: http://www.nursingboard.state.nv.us Phone: 888-590-6726 E-mail: [email protected] Renewal requirements: 30 contact hours of board-approved CE within the past 2 years. Effective 1/1/2005, the 30 hours must include 4 hours of a board-approved course on bioterrorism.
